Havering’s first-ever Ninja Knife bin has seen the surrender of 271 knives and bladed items taken off the borough’s streets, in its first six months.

A permanent knife surrender bin will remain in Central Park Leisure Centre car park, Harold Hill, to allow people to anonymously and safely dispose of knives and other weapons.
